Former Niger Delta agitators Mujahid Asare Dokubo and Government Ekpemupolo a.k.a Tompolo are on warpath following the pipeline security contract awarded by the Federal government to Tompolo.

Asare Dokubo who is the founder of the Niger-Delta People Volunteer Force (NDPVF), is raging over how the FG summarily, awarded the contract to protect the pipe-lines criss-crossing the Niger Delta region to Tompolo who was the leader of the Movement for the Emancipation of Niger-Delta (MEND), in their days ‘fighting’ for better government presence in the ravaged oil producing region.

Asare Dokubo warned Tompolo to stay away from Bayelsa and Rivers States. He said in a video circulating on social media: “You (Tompolo) took pipeline contract in Delta, your place, and then you come to Kalabari to take pipeline contract because you are an Ijaw man; because only you know how to chop.

“You take from Gbaramatu land, you take Itsekiri people own, you take Urhobo people own, you take Isoko people own, you take Kwale people own, you take all.

“You take the whole of Bayelsa own and then you come to Kalabari. If Timipre Sylva gave you because he wants to clip my wings, when he was a House of Assembly member, did I clip his wing?

“I am older than he is. When he was governor, did I clip his wings? That I am becoming too powerful, so he connived and gave pipeline contract so that he will destroy what we are doing to make the government he is part of, stable.

“Therefore, he brought Tompolo and Tompolo gathered people and told them he would buy guns and give them. Let them come. I am not boasting. I think soldiers will guard him here. Let them come. I did not talk about Rivers state. I said Kalabari. They cannot take it. Let them take any place they like, not Kalabari.

“You are collecting over N4.5 billion a month for doing nothing and people come to Oporoza to support you. Leave the pipeline in Kalabari here, you cannot take it. Take other places, it is Ijaw land, yes. But this one in Kalabari, you cannot take it.”

Tompolo has not responded to Asare-Dokubo’s tirade. There is no indication that he would, being an evasive fellow.
